Carlos Alcaraz voices frustration over Rod Laver Arena roof closure during Australian Open final

Carlos Alcaraz expressed frustration with Australian Open organizers over the partial closure of the Rod Laver Arena roof during his final match against Novak Djokovic. The decision to close the roof, despite no rain, was made before the third set. Alcaraz believed it disadvantaged him, with some pundits agreeing that outdoor conditions should be maintained when dry. The partial closure was intended to mitigate potential rain. An open roof would have created windier conditions, potentially favoring Alcaraz.
